Key Takeaways

The tracker and its accompanying report found no evidence of a statewide surge in layoffs among those working in highly AI-exposed jobs. California governor Gavin Newsom just announced a statewide tracker that follows AI-related unemployment claims—and said it’s the first tool of its kind in the country.
